The Southeast U.S.-Canadian Provinces (SEUS-CP) Alliance was established in 2007 to present the opportunity for businesses to enhance commercial ties, promote two-way trade and investment and encourage technological exchanges between the member states and Canadian provinces. The Alliance reinforces the importance of the long-standing U.S.-Canadian relationship and expands commercial opportunities in underdeveloped sectors and markets […]

Peru has been one of the fastest-growing Latin American economies since 2002 and is known for its prudent fiscal policies. Structural reforms and sound macroeconomic policies created high growth, low inflation, and reduced poverty.
